//-------------------------------------------------
// get_compression_defaults - use CHD metadata to
// pick the preferred type
//-------------------------------------------------
static const std::array<chd_codec_type, 4> &get_compression_defaults(chd_file &input_chd)
{
std::error_condition err = input_chd.check_is_hd();
if (err == chd_file::error::METADATA_NOT_FOUND)
err = input_chd.check_is_dvd();
if (!err)
return s_default_hd_compression;
if (err != chd_file::error::METADATA_NOT_FOUND)
throw err;
err = input_chd.check_is_av();
if (!err)
return s_default_ld_compression;
if (err != chd_file::error::METADATA_NOT_FOUND)
throw err;
err = input_chd.check_is_cd();
if (err == chd_file::error::METADATA_NOT_FOUND)
err = input_chd.check_is_gd();
if (!err)
return s_default_cd_compression;
if (err != chd_file::error::METADATA_NOT_FOUND)
throw err;
return s_default_raw_compression;
}
